Which is the right answer. OK, let's recap the vocabulary we've learned in this programme, starting with yealling, another word for shouting.
To pacify someone means to calm them down when they're angry.
In the near future means very soon, or within a short time.
The phrase, as a matter of fact is used to add emphasis to what you're saying, to give more detail about what you've just said,, or to introduce something that contrasts with it.
If you're empathetic, you're able to put yourself in someone else's position and share their feelings or experiences.
And finally, filler words like 'um', 'ah' and 'you know' give the speaker more time to think, or to express uncertainty.
